From cabfe2cdc0b8d879431f81233addd2a43ff1f742 Mon Sep 17 00:00:00 2001 From: Rickard Green Date: Wed, 11 Sep 2013 21:49:32 +0200 Subject: Implement platform specific aligned sys_alloc and use when supported erts_sys_aligned_alloc() is currently implemented using posix_memalign if it exist, or using _aligned_malloc on Windows.
